华为云提供了多种Linux镜像系统,选择“好用”的镜像主要取决于你的具体使用场景(如开发、运维、生产环境、性能要求等)。以下是几款常见且推荐的Linux镜像及其适用场景,供你参考:
1. CentOS
- 特点:
- 稳定、企业级、广泛用于服务器环境。
- 软件生态丰富,社区支持强大。
- 华为云提供优化版本(如 CentOS + 华为云驱动)。
- 注意:CentOS 8 已停止维护,建议使用 CentOS Stream 或转向替代系统。
- 适用场景:传统企业应用、Web服务、数据库服务器。
✅ 推荐指数:⭐⭐⭐⭐(但建议考虑替代品)
2. EulerOS / OpenEuler
- 特点:
- 华为自研的企业级Linux发行版,深度适配华为云硬件和鲲鹏处理器。
- 高安全性、高可靠性,适合关键业务系统。
- OpenEuler 是开源社区版本,持续更新,生态发展迅速。
- 优势:
- 与华为云服务集成更好(如监控、驱动、性能优化)。
- 支持ARM架构(鲲鹏),对国产化需求友好。
- 适用场景:政企项目、国产化替代、高性能计算、云原生环境。
✅ 推荐指数:⭐⭐⭐⭐⭐(尤其是国产化或华为生态用户)
3. Ubuntu
- 特点:
- 用户友好,社区活跃,软件包丰富。
- 更新频繁,支持最新技术(如Docker、Kubernetes、AI框架)。
- 华为云提供官方镜像,兼容性好。
- 适用场景:开发测试、容器化部署、AI/机器学习、初创项目。
✅ 推荐指数:⭐⭐⭐⭐⭐(通用性强,适合大多数用户)
4. Debian
- 特点:
- 极其稳定,轻量,资源占用低。
- 软件包管理强大(apt),适合长期运行的服务。
- 缺点:软件版本较旧,不适合需要新特性的场景。
- 适用场景:小型VPS、基础服务(如DNS、Nginx)、稳定性优先的环境。
✅ 推荐指数:⭐⭐⭐⭐
5. Alibaba Cloud Linux / Anolis OS(也可在华为云使用)
- 注意:虽然不是华为原生,但部分镜像可通过自定义方式导入。
- 类似于阿里云优化的CentOS替代品,性能优秀。
- 如果你熟悉阿里云生态,可考虑迁移。
🏆 综合推荐(按场景):
| 使用场景 | 推荐镜像 |
|---|---|
| 通用开发/部署 | Ubuntu 20.04/22.04 LTS |
| 企业级生产环境 | OpenEuler 或 CentOS Stream |
| 国产化/信创项目 | OpenEuler(首选) |
| 高性能计算/鲲鹏架构 | OpenEuler |
| 轻量级服务/低资源消耗 | Debian 11/12 |
| 兼容传统应用 | CentOS Stream 9 |
🔧 小贴士:
- 在华为云控制台选择镜像时,优先选择标注为“公共镜像”且由“Huawei”或“Canonical”等官方提供的版本。
- 建议选择 LTS(长期支持)版本,确保安全更新。
- 启用华为云的 主机监控插件 和 cloud-init 支持,便于自动化配置。
总结:
- 大多数用户推荐 Ubuntu LTS:易用、生态好、社区强。
- 政企/国产化用户推荐 OpenEuler:自主可控、深度优化。
- 传统运维用户可选 CentOS Stream:平滑过渡。
你可以根据项目需求在华为云镜像市场中搜索并对比各版本。如有特定应用(如MySQL、Nginx、Docker),建议选择已预装优化组件的“市场镜像”或自行使用公共镜像搭建。
需要我帮你生成一个选型决策树吗?
秒懂云